What we’re looking for: We're looking for a Lead Data Analyst to craft insightful and compelling data stories, empower business owners across Nexamp to make more effective data-driven decisions, and help build our self-service data platform. As one of the nation’s largest and longest tenured solar and storage owner operators – and one of the few that is fully vertically integrated – our data is a differentiator in the market and a catalyst for future growth. You’ll be solving uniquely challenging data problems, alongside a strong team, and for a company in which the business model and mission are inseparably intertwined: our solar farms save customers money, help the planet, and are profitable for Nexamp and its investors. You will be hybrid out of our Boston office. You will report to the Director, Product Management - Data.

Responsibilities

  • Independently gather requirements for, prioritize, deliver, maintain, and continuously improve reusable data models, dashboards, analyses, A/B tests, and other data assets.
  • Act as the product manager and implementer for your domain’s data offerings.
  • Implement work using advanced SQL and BI tool skills.
  • Become the subject matter expert for data in your business areas.
  • Identify opportunities for impact, proactively surface insights, support decision-making, and contribute to and influence business strategy and initiatives.
  • Serve as your business stakeholders’ right hand.
  • Support other business areas opportunistically.
  • Create and maintain comprehensive data documentation and communicate updates to your stakeholders.
  • Write user stories or tickets for data engineering, validate data mapping, conduct QA, and implement data quality monitoring.
  • Monitor the usage of data assets, increase data literacy, and promote self-service through BI tools among stakeholders.
  • Provide training, guidance, and support as needed.
  • Work within a centralized data team using agile methodologies.
  • Collaborate with peer analysts through overlapping work, priority shifting, and code reviews to broaden your Nexamp knowledge.
  • Partner with the data architect, engineers, scientists, and analysts to shape the vision and roadmap for Nexamp’s data platform.
  • Define and track annual OKRs to measure your impact.
